WebThe Countess of Montgomery's Urania, also known as Urania, is a prose romance by English Renaissance writer Lady Mary Wroth. Composed at the beginning of the 17th century, it is the first known prose romance written by an English woman.

Wroth broke gender … sometimes i think about you tiktokWebLady Mary Wroth was the first Englishwoman to write a complete sonnet sequence, Pamphilia to Amphilanthus. She was also the first English woman to compose an extended work of romantic prose, The Countesse of Mountgomeries Urania.
